Clearly shows by symbols , notations , or delineations , those <br /> constructed improvements located by the survey . <br /> 1 . Right- of-way Swale/ Drainage — All culvert inverts , elevations and station <br /> offsets ; inlet grate and bottom elevations ; swale beginning and end bottom <br /> elevations ; and highs and lows along top of bank . Size of swale . <br /> 2 . Pipe Culvert/ PVC Sleeves — All inverts , stations and offsets . <br /> 3 . Outfalls — All pipe inverts , elevations and station offsets , weir box elevations , <br /> weir elevation , and sizes . <br /> 4 . Roadway/Off Site Drainage — All inverts , elevations and station offsets ; <br /> manhole top elevation ; grate top elevations . <br /> 5 . Retention Ponds — Perimeter elevations , grade breaks , depths , and calculate <br /> pond area at control elevation and grade breaks above water surface . <br /> 6 . Roadway : <br /> a . Stations and offset related to controlling baseline and elevations of all <br /> structures , side street and major driveway radius returns ( edge of <br /> pavement ) , bends and /or change in direction of roadway alignment , OR <br /> minimum at 1000 ' intervals along roadway alignment . <br /> b . Elevations along Profile Grade Line ( PGL ) , of all edge of pavements either <br /> side of Profile Grade Line ( PGL ) , at medians at the high / low and PVI <br /> points along Profile Grade Line ( PGL ) . <br /> c . All final Elevations to be plotted on PGL AND Plan - Profile sheets as <br /> applicable . <br /> d . Elevations of edge of pavement and flow line at curb inlets and on the <br /> adjacent edge of pavement at curb inlets . <br /> SURVEY CONTROL <br /> 1 . Install / re -establish : It shall be the contractor' s responsibility to hire a <br /> Professional Surveyor and Mapper as defined per Chapter 472 , Florida <br /> Statutes , to replace any horizontal and vertical control shown on the <br /> engineering plans that was destroyed during construction . <br /> 2 . New roadway alignment control points ( Survey Baseline or controlling line and all <br /> points as indicated on the plans or control sheet ) upon final roadway completion . <br /> Include all intersections and side streets . State Plane Coordinates and <br /> elevations for all control points . <br /> 3 . Either if shown on plans or not : Any Public Land Corner or Governmental <br /> Survey Control point ( s ) , vertical control ( bench marks ) , property corners <br /> destroyed and /or disturbed during the scope of the project shall be properly re - <br /> established as per standards as set forth within Florida Statutes , Administrative <br /> code and Minimum Technical Standards for that type of survey . All said <br /> surveying mentioned above shall be performed underthe direct supervision of a <br /> registered Professional Surveyor and Mapper in the state of Florida and <br /> certified accordingly . Said Governmental agency( s ) shall be notified in writing of <br /> disturbance and re- establishments . <br /> Technical Specifications <br /> F •\ Piihlir 1A/ nrkc\ FNc; iNFFRINC; nivic; InN RH Phaca 11 (d'3rri Ava to 77th AvP.. \\ Arlmim\hitt <br />
